Key Responsibilities:
Executive Assistant Duties:

Manage complex scheduling across multiple time zones, including professional meetings, virtual calls, and personal engagements Liaise with business contacts, board members, and advisors on the principal’s behalf Handle confidential documents, organize files, and assist with special business projects and presentations Prepare meeting briefs, talking points, and follow-ups as needed Monitor and respond to high-volume email inboxes with tact and efficiency Coordinate with professional staff (legal, finance, PR, etc.) and manage deadlines and deliverables Book and coordinate business travel (air, ground, hotel, itineraries) Track expenses and prepare simple reports or liaise with accountant/bookkeeper as needed

Personal Assistant Duties:

Handle daily to-do lists and prioritize personal tasks for the principal Run errands, handle returns/exchanges, coordinate dry cleaning, pharmacy, etc. Maintain wardrobe management, packing/unpacking, seasonal rotation, and returns Source and purchase luxury items, gifts, personal care products, and home items Book personal appointments: health/wellness, beauty, dining, etc. Provide support with social calendar and RSVP/event coordination Arrange occasional personal travel and detailed itineraries Serve as a discreet liaison for friends, family, and personal service providers

Household Manager Duties:

Oversee all household operations for a well-appointed Manhattan residence Supervise vendors, service staff, contractors, and cleaners to ensure excellence and discretion Manage household schedules for deep cleaning, maintenance, seasonal décor, etc. Maintain household manuals, contact lists, passwords, and project trackers Manage home inventory and order restocks (groceries, supplies, specialty items) Oversee home organization systems—closets, kitchen, storage, etc. Assist in planning and executing small in-home events or gatherings Conduct regular walkthroughs to ensure cleanliness, comfort, and guest readiness Coordinate tech support, repairs, home deliveries, and troubleshooting
